How To Choose The Best Prickly Pear Supplement
Prickly pear supplements vary widely in drying method, cactus variety, capsule count, and added ingredients. A bottle that looks like a steal on price per capsule may be hiding sun-dried or heat-dried powder that has lost most of its natural pigment and phytonutrient density. Here are the three factors that separate a solid daily nopal capsule from a shelf ornament.
Drying Method — Freeze-Dried Wins Every Time
The moment a cactus pad is exposed to high heat, the betalains (the compounds responsible for the vibrant red-purple color in prickly pear fruit) and heat-sensitive nitrates begin to degrade. Freeze-drying removes water at sub-zero temperatures, locking in the natural green color, aroma, and plant-based fiber structure. If you see “sun-dried” or simply “dried” on the label, the nutrient profile is likely compromised before the capsule is even sealed.
Cactus Variety and Origin
Not all prickly pear cactus is created equal. The traditional medicinal species is Opuntia streptacantha, native to central Mexico. Generic “cactus powder” often comes from bulk Opuntia ficus-indica grown in arid regions with lower soil mineral content. A supplement that names its specific variety and growing region (high-elevation volcanic soil is ideal) signals traceability and intentional sourcing rather than anonymous commodity blending.
Potency Per Capsule and Servings Per Bottle
Many brands advertise a high milligram number on the front label but hide that it takes multiple capsules to reach that serving size. A 2000mg serving may require four 500mg capsules. Look at the Supplement Facts panel for the per-capsule strength, then calculate how many days a bottle lasts at the recommended serving. A higher per-capsule potency (650mg to 1500mg per capsule) means fewer pills to swallow and a simpler daily routine.

1. Natural Home Cures Freeze-Dried Nopal Cactus
This is the only product in the lineup that uses a freeze-drying process instead of heat or sun drying. That single choice preserves the capsule’s natural green color and the betalain content that heat-sensitive dieters depend on for antioxidant support. Each 500mg capsule is built from whole Opuntia streptacantha powder, not a generic cactus blend, so you are getting the traditional Mexican nopal variety that has been used in folk medicine for generations.
Verified buyers consistently point to blood glucose balance as the standout benefit, with multiple reviews reporting improved A1C and steadier energy throughout the day. The capsules are vegan, non-GMO, and free from flow agents like silicon dioxide and magnesium stearate — a rarity in the supplement aisle. The 120-capsule bottle provides enough for 60 servings at the recommended two-capsule serving, making the freeze-dried premium accessible without requiring a huge upfront commitment.
The main trade-off is the lower per-capsule milligram count compared to brands that pack 650mg or 1000mg into a single pill. If you prefer fewer capsules per serving, this one requires two capsules to reach 1000mg. But for buyers who prioritize processing purity and whole-plant preservation over convenience, this is the cleanest nopal capsule available.

2. Eleva Nutrition Organic Nopal Cactus 1500mg
Eleva Nutrition takes a different approach by pairing organic sun-dried nopal powder with black pepper extract. The piperine in black pepper is clinically shown to increase the bioavailability of certain plant compounds, and here it helps the digestive system absorb more of the cactus fiber, vitamins, and minerals. The 1500mg serving (three capsules) delivers a potent dose, and the 240-capsule bottle provides a full two-month supply at that serving level.
Customer reviews highlight appetite suppression as a frequent effect, with one verified buyer noting that a single capsule kept them full all day. Others report noticeable reductions in neuropathy-related nerve discomfort and better fasting glucose numbers compared to pharmaceutical alternatives. The company uses organic sun-dried cactus grown in Mexico, and the capsules are vegan-friendly with no GMOs, gluten, or soy.
The sun-drying method is a step down from freeze-drying in terms of preserving heat-sensitive nutrients, but the inclusion of black pepper extract partially compensates by improving how well the body uses what survives the drying process. The capsules are on the larger side, and a few reviewers found three capsules per day caused excessive fullness.

4. Nopalina Original Fiber Powder
Nopalina takes a fundamentally different approach by offering a fiber powder rather than capsules. The blend combines organic nopal with flaxseed, psyllium husk, and a mix of soluble and insoluble fibers, creating a digestive support product that is richer in total fiber than any capsule can provide. Each serving delivers Omega-3, 6, and 9 fatty acids from the flaxseed, which adds a heart-healthy angle that standalone nopal capsules do not offer.
Verified users praise Nopalina for its effectiveness in promoting regularity, reducing bloating, and keeping you full between meals. Multiple reviewers mention adding it to smoothies or sprinkling it over cereal, since the taste is described as earthy but tolerable when mixed into food. The manufacturing facility is FDA-registered and GMP-certified, and the powder is Kosher. A single container provides 60 servings, making it a strong value proposition for anyone who prioritizes digestive health over isolated nopal dosing.
The biggest difference from the capsule products is convenience. You cannot toss a scoop of powder into your bag and take it on the go the way you can with capsules. The earthy flavor also means you will need to mix it with something palatable. For buyers who nopal strictly for glycemic control, the added flax and psyllium dilute the cactus concentration.
